Transaction 621666edcd5faa8b8da9d7df261499bf62a1beb80db66a8ca691781115341768
1 Input
1 Output
-
621666edcd5faa8b8da9d7df261499bf62a1beb80db66a8ca691781115341768:0
- value
- 20000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b8a78598694097cf7e6ed2040f2ba7630f14701645776332acf631a58abbb09b
- address
- bc1phznctxrfgztu7lnw6gzq72a8vv83guqkg4mkxv4v7cc6tz4mkzds4z90ua